comparemela.com
Home
Super 8 Lincoln Il
Top Locations Tagged with Super 8 Lincoln Il
Super 8 Lincoln Il in United States - 62656/Motels near Logan
1). Super 8 Lincoln
2). Super 8 Lincoln Illinois
Super 8 Lincoln Il in United States - 68521/Motels near Lancaster
3). Super 8 Lincoln/Cornhusker Hwy
Super 8 Lincoln Il in United States - 88345/Motels near Lincoln
4). Super8
Super 8 Lincoln Il in United States - 69101/Lodging near Lincoln
5). Super 8, W Eugene Ave
Super 8 Lincoln Il in United States - 80828/Motels near Lincoln
6). Super 8, St Hwy /
7). Super 8, Us Highway
vimarsana © 2020. All Rights Reserved.